Job Description Addison Group is hiring a Human Resources Manager on behalf of our client, a well-established manufacturing organization. This role will serve as the onsite HR leader and primary point of contact for all people‑related initiatives. The ideal candidate will be comfortable building HR infrastructure, supporting employees directly, and partnering closely with executive leadership in a hands‑on environment.
This position is fully onsite and will support multiple nearby manufacturing locations as needed.
Key Responsibilities
Oversee day‑to‑day HR operations, serving as the central resource for employees and leadership
Lead full‑cycle recruiting efforts, onboarding processes, and employee lifecycle activities
Manage employee relations matters, performance discussions, and policy interpretation
Administer benefits communication and act as a liaison between employees and benefit providers
Create, update, and maintain HR policies, procedures, and employee handbook materials
Develop and scale HR processes as the organization grows, including future team expansion
Ensure compliance with employment laws, regulations, and internal standards
Partner with leadership to align HR initiatives with business objectives
Qualifications
5+ years of progressive HR management experience within a manufacturing or industrial environment
Bachelor’s degree required
Demonstrated experience building or enhancing HR functions in smaller or growing organizations
Strong working knowledge of HR best practices across recruiting, employee relations, and compliance
Hands‑on leadership style with the ability to work directly with employees at all levels
Proven stability in employment history with consistent tenure
Adaptable, flexible, and comfortable operating in a fast‑paced, evolving environment
Preferred
SHRM‑CP or PHR certification
Bilingual (English/Spanish)
